What Should You Look for in the Best Data Science Course in Pune?


Now that we’ve established the importance of practicality, integration with industry, and strong fundamentals, you’re probably wondering how to actually choose the right course. While I won’t recommend any institute by name, I can guide you on what to look for.

Start by evaluating the course curriculum. Is it updated? Does it include real-time projects? Will you get access to industry-grade tools like Python, SQL, Tableau, or cloud platforms? Does the course mention how it incorporates enterprise data scenarios—perhaps even SAP-related datasets?

Next, consider the trainers. Are they active professionals? Do they bring experience from companies that actually use data science in production? A good instructor doesn’t just teach—they mentor, they challenge, and they share wisdom that goes beyond the syllabus.

Also, look into whether the course offers support beyond the classroom. Resume reviews, mock interviews, industry talks, and placement guidance are signs that a training provider is serious about your career—not just your enrollment.

Finally, talk to past students if you can. Ask about the kind of projects they worked on, the clarity they gained, and how confident they felt applying for jobs afterward. That feedback is often more valuable than any brochure.
